Hyatt Regency Times Square is perfectly located in the heart of Times Square excitement, situated directly on Broadway between 48th and 49th Streets. This iconic, ultra-modern, full-service hotel is surrounded by Broadway theaters and close to world-famous shopping and sightseeing. The hotel has 795 modern, newly renovated guestrooms.
The Housekeeping Manager at Hyatt Regency Times Square is responsible for overseeing the daily operations of the housekeeping department to ensure the highest standards of cleanliness, guest satisfaction, and colleague engagement are consistently achieved. This leader will manage room attendants, house attendants, public area attendants, and laundry operations while ensuring adherence to Hyatt brand standards, Property specific cleanliness guidelines, and health and safety protocols. The position requires a hands-on leader with exceptional attention to detail, strong organizational skills, and the ability to drive operational excellence in a fast-paced, high-volume environment.

Education & Experience:
Minimum 3–5 years of progressive housekeeping or rooms division management experience in a full-service or luxury hotel (preferably in a high-volume, urban property).
Prior experience with unionized environments preferred.
Strong familiarity with Hyatt brand standards, Opera, Colleague advantage, BOB systems is highly desirable.
